Life’s a bit simpler – VSAM Space reclaim in z/OS 1.12

Life’s a bit simpler – VSAM Space reclaim in z/OS 1.12

July 7, 2010 1 Comment

Inserting and deleting records in VSAM KSDS’s seemed to always cause fragmentation – and that meant that there was extra I/O and that meant CPU time – taking the data off line to reorganize indexes and data files meant again – longer batch streams and outages of the online applications.
